Course Content

• Introduction to Robotics: Fundamentals and Applications
• Robotics Sensors and Actuators: Sensor Fusion and Control Systems
• Robot Programming and Control: Industrial Robot Programming Languages and Simulation
• Robot Motion Planning and Navigation: Path Planning Algorithms and Autonomous Navigation
• Robotics in Manufacturing: Industrial Automation and Robotics Integration
• AI and Machine Learning in Robotics: Deep Learning for Robotics and Computer Vision
• Ethical and Societal Implications of Robotics: Responsible Robotics Development and Deployment
• Advanced Robotics Topics: Human-Robot Interaction and Collaborative Robots (Cobots)

Career path

Career Role (Robotics Essentials & Applications) Description
Robotics Engineer (Automation & Control) Design, develop, and maintain robotic systems for industrial automation, focusing on precise control and efficient processes. High demand.
AI Robotics Specialist (Machine Learning) Develop intelligent robotic systems using machine learning algorithms for tasks like object recognition, navigation, and decision-making. Rapidly growing field.
Robotics Technician (Maintenance & Repair) Troubleshoot, repair, and maintain robotic equipment, ensuring optimal performance and minimizing downtime in manufacturing and other sectors. Essential role.
Robotics Software Engineer (Programming & Simulation) Develop and implement software for robotic systems, including simulations and control algorithms. Strong programming skills required.
Robotics Research Scientist (Innovation & Development) Conduct research and development in advanced robotics technologies, pushing the boundaries of innovation. Highly specialized and competitive.
